The U.S. House of Representatives passed a resolution supporting Israel and condemning Palestinian leaders for the ongoing violence in the West Bank and Gaza Strip. The nonbinding measure, which was passed by a vote of 365 to 30, condemned Yasser Arafat and other Palestinian leaders for “encouraging the violence and doing so little for so long to stop it, resulting in the senseless loss of life.”
